Christopher K. Starkey was a candidate for the Marion County Superior Court in Indiana.[1]

Elections

2014

See also: Indiana judicial elections, 2014
Starkey ran for election to the Marion County Superior Court.
Primary: He was defeated in the Democratic primary on May 6, 2014, receiving 3.4 percent of the vote. He competed against Annie Christ-Garcia, Barbara Cook Crawford, Angela Davis, David J. Dreyer, Shatrese M. Flowers, David R. Hennessy, Mark A. Jones, Christina R. Klineman, James B. Osborn, Marcel A. Pratt, Jr., Greg Bowes and Karen Celestino-Horseman. There were 16 total seats up for election on this court. The top 8 Democratic candidates advanced to the general election and will be unopposed for the eight available Democratic seats. Indianapolis Bar Association survey

Yes check.svg Members of the Indianapolis Bar Association "Did Not Recommended" Starkey for judicial office with 71.9 percent of respondents not in favor. For full results, see Indianapolis Bar Association Judicial Survey, Christopher K. Starkey.
